Notice of Public Meeting: Northeast California Resource Advisory 
Council Wild Horse and Burro Management Subcommittee

AGENCY: Bureau of Land Management, Interior.

ACTION: Notice of Public Meeting.

-----------------------------------------------------------------------

SUMMARY: In accordance with the Federal Land Policy and Management Act 
of 1976 (FLPMA), and the Federal Advisory Committee Act of 1972 (FACA), 
the U. S. Department of the Interior, Bureau of Land Management (BLM) 
Northeast California Resource Advisory Council's wild horse and burro 
management subcommittee will meet as indicated below.

DATES: The committee will meet Wednesday, Jan. 11, at 9 a.m., at the 
BLM Alturas Field Office, 708 West 12th St., Alturas, California. The 
meeting is open to the public.

FOR FURTHER INFORMATION CONTACT: Nancy Haug, BLM Northern California 
District manager, (530) 224-2160; or Joseph J. Fontana, BLM public 
affairs officer, (530) 252-5332.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The subcommittee was formed by the 15-member 
Northeast California Resource Advisory Council to work on issues 
associated with management of wild horses and burros on public lands 
managed by the BLM Eagle Lake, Alturas and Surprise field offices. The 
subcommittee reports to the full advisory council. The northeast 
California Resource Advisory Council advises the Secretary of the 
Interior, through the BLM, on a variety of planning and management 
issues associated with public land management in northeast California 
and the northwest corner of Nevada. The topic for the subcommittee 
meeting is developing recommendations on wild horse and burro program
